Is Siri AI or Machine Learning? Understanding the Technology Behind Siri
In the world of virtual assistants, Siri is one of the most well-known and widely used. Created by Apple, Siri has become an integral part of the user experience for millions of people around the world. However, there is often confusion about the technology behind Siri—is it artificial intelligence (AI), machine learning, or both? In this article, we will delve into the technology that powers Siri and understand the intricate relationship between AI and machine learning in creating this innovative virtual assistant.
AI, Machine Learning, and Siri
Artificial intelligence refers to the ability of a machine or a computer program to think and learn. It is the overarching concept that encompasses various technologies, including natural language processing, machine learning, and deep learning. Machine learning, on the other hand, is a subset of AI that enables a computer system to learn from data and improve its performance over time without being explicitly programmed.
Siri utilizes a combination of AI and machine learning to provide users with a personalized and intelligent virtual assistant experience. When a user interacts with Siri, natural language processing algorithms analyze the user’s voice input and convert it into actionable commands. This is where AI comes into play, allowing Siri to understand and respond to human language in a way that feels natural and intuitive.
Machine learning plays a significant role in enhancing Siri’s capabilities over time. As Siri interacts with users and gathers data, machine learning algorithms continuously analyze this information to improve the accuracy of Siri’s responses, personalize recommendations, and adapt to individual user preferences. This enables Siri to anticipate user needs and provide more relevant and helpful suggestions as it learns from user interactions.
Deep Learning and Siri
In addition to machine learning, deep learning—a subset of machine learning that uses neural networks to mimic the human brain—also contributes to Siri’s advanced capabilities. Deep learning enables Siri to process and interpret complex patterns in data, such as understanding natural language, recognizing speech, and identifying images. This technology empowers Siri to perform tasks like image recognition, language translation, and providing more accurate and context-aware responses to user queries.
One of the key advantages of deep learning in the context of Siri is its ability to continuously improve the accuracy and performance of the virtual assistant. This means that as Siri encounters new scenarios and learns from user interactions, its understanding and predictive capabilities become more refined, contributing to a more natural and personalized user experience.
Siri’s Future Evolution
As technology continues to advance, the future of Siri is likely to be shaped by ongoing developments in AI and machine learning. Apple, as the developer of Siri, is committed to enhancing the virtual assistant’s capabilities by integrating cutting-edge technologies and improving its ability to understand and cater to the diverse needs of users.
Advancements in natural language processing, contextual understanding, and personalized recommendations are expected to further elevate Siri’s intelligence and utility. This will likely involve leveraging advancements in machine learning and deep learning to create a more intuitive and context-aware virtual assistant that can seamlessly integrate into users’ daily lives.
In conclusion, Siri is a sophisticated virtual assistant that leverages AI, machine learning, and deep learning to provide users with a personalized and intelligent experience. By constantly learning and adapting to user interactions, Siri continues to evolve, offering more intuitive and context-aware responses. As technology progresses, Siri’s capabilities are poised to further expand, demonstrating the boundless potential of AI and machine learning in shaping the future of virtual assistants.